a. kernel panic position
file : linux-2.6.x/arch/microblaze/kernel/setup.c
funtion : machine_early_init(const char *cmdline)
position of function
void machine_early_init(const char *cmdline)
{
unsigned long *src, *dst = (unsigned long *)0x0;
#ifdef CONFIG_MTD_UCLINUX_EBSS
{
int size;
extern char *klimit;
extern char *_ebss;
/* if CONFIG_MTD_UCLINUX_EBSS is defined, assume ROMFS is at
the * end of kernel, which is ROMFS_LOCATION defined
above. */
//size = romfs_get_size((struct romfs_super_block
*)__init_end); size = PAGE_ALIGN(get_romfs_len(get_romfs_base()));
early_printk("Found romfs @ 0x%08x (0x%08x)\n",
get_romfs_base(), size);
early_printk("#### klimit %p ####\n", klimit);
BUG_ON(size < 0); /* What else can we do? */
/* Use memmove to handle likely case of memory overlap */
early_printk("Moving 0x%08x bytes from 0x%08x to 0x%08x\n",
size, get_romfs_base(), &_ebss);
memmove(&_ebss, get_romfs_base(), size);
/* update klimit */
klimit += PAGE_ALIGN(size);
early_printk("New klimit: 0x%08x\n",klimit);
}
#endif
memset(__bss_start, 0, __bss_stop-__bss_start); <-- panic
memset(_ssbss, 0, _esbss-_ssbss);
/* Copy command line passed from bootloader, or use default
if none provided, or forced */
#ifndef CONFIG_CMDLINE_FORCE
if (cmdline && cmdline[0]!='\0')
strlcpy(command_line, cmdline, COMMAND_LINE_SIZE);
else
#endif
strlcpy(command_line, default_command_line, COMMAND_LINE_SIZE);
__bss_start value ==> 0x441bb000
__bss_stop value ==> 0x441ce6dc
__bss_stop - __bss_start ==> 0x136dc
(__bss_stop - __bss_start) < romfs_get_size
